Freigeben über


Datensätze

Datensätze sind eine Möglichkeit, zwischen Knoten in einem Diagramm oder Mitgliedern in einer Gruppe zu kommunizieren. Ein Datensatz besteht aus den folgenden zwei Teilen:

  • Datensatzheader
  • Spezifischer undurchsichtiger Dateninhalt

Der Header enthält Informationen zum Datensatz, einschließlich Version, Ersteller und Typ der veröffentlichten Daten. Der Header enthält auch ein XML-Attributfeld, mit dem Anwendungen Namen-Wert-Attribute hinzufügen können, die die Daten beschreiben, und die Datensatzdatenbank effizient nach bestimmten Datensätzen durchsuchen können, die zuvor veröffentlicht wurden. Der Inhalt sind die von der Anwendung definierten Daten und sind für die Peerinfrastruktur undurchsichtig.

Wenn ein Datensatz veröffentlicht wird, wird er (sowohl Header als auch Daten) im gesamten Diagramm oder in der Gruppe überflutet. Synchronisierte Peers empfangen diese Daten und speichern sie in einer lokalen Datenbank. Nicht synchronisierte und Offline-Peers erhalten die Daten, wenn sie das nächste Mal eine Verbindung mit dem Peerdiagramm oder der Peergruppe herstellen und synchronisieren.

Informationen zum Arbeiten mit Datensätzen finden Sie in den folgenden Themen: